Sabyasachi - The "King of Kitsch"

Sabyasachi Mukherjee a.k.a the “King of Kitsch” has earned a place in the hall of fashion fame with his unique style and artistic taste. This young talented designer has received accolades and earned the respect of fashionistas around the globe. His work has a sentimental appeal; with gaudy undertones - just enough to make it hip; a true artistic fusion of traditional and contemporary designs thus kitsch.
 

 The 28 year old Kolkata based designer, graduated from the esteemed National Institute of Fashion Technology (NIFT) in 1999. From then on, it has been a journey with no looking back. Sabyasachi launched his own label right after graduation and currently owns a retail chain in all the major cities of India.

 
In 2001, Sabyasachi won the Femina British Council Most Outstanding Young Designer of India award. In 2003, he made his International label by bagging the grand winner award at Mercedes New Asia Fashion Week in Singapore. In 2004, he represented India at the Milan Fashion Week. Talking about fashion week, he has been a participant at the New York Fashion Week for the past three years.
 
One thing I love about Sabyasachi is that he is a diehard fan of Indian textile, Indian style and culture. His creations comprise of Indian traditional wear, bridal wear and Indo-western wear. While his contemporaries are taking inspiration from the west, he draws his inspiration from the Indian culture, promoting the Indian heritage. He describes his collection as “an international styling with an Indian soul”. Sabyasachi uses unusual fabrics, texturing and detailing, 'fusion' of styles 'patch-worked' with gorgeous embellishments in a vibrant eclectic color palette to make the feeling of going back to the ancient and medieval ages.
